Lionel Messi poses for a series of never-before-published photographs taken by Domenico Dolce especially for this unique book. Rising from Rosario, an Argentine town in Santa Fe Province, "Leo" has become the foremost soccer player in the world. He is the forward for FC Barcelona and the Argentine national team, as well as the winner of the Ballon d’Or for four years in a row since 2009. The portraits selected for this project disclose an unconventional Messi, very different from the one seen at matches. As a matter of fact, the book showcases the star player’s private, more intimate life captured by Domenico Dolce’s creativity and unfailing eye. The photographs will be printed on special gold and silver paper. The images lay bare the emotions, moods, and passions of this young athlete, who has succeeded in bravely overcoming adversity in order to fulfill his dream: to become the number one among the world’s top soccer players.

For soccer enthusiasts and sports fans in general, an in-depth look at the life of the beautiful game’s greatest star, Argentine footballer Lionel Messi. Whether you call it soccer, football, fútbol, or the “beautiful game," it is the most popular sport in the world, and Argentine footballer Lionel Messi stands as one of its finest players—not only of his time, but of all time. Admired around the globe for his athleticism, skill, and fierce competitiveness, Messi has, at the age of 24, already shattered records at one of the most storied clubs in the world, FC Barcelona. Now, in this comprehensive biography, Messi fans can learn more about his life and career. Argentine journalist Leonardo Faccio describes how Messi, as a talented youth player in Buenos Aires, left his home for Spain in search of the medical help his family could not afford to treat his rare hormone deficiency. Small of stature, but possessing tremendous natural gifts, Messi developed into a star at Barcelona’s famed Masia soccer school. In this book, Faccio has written not only a biography of an enigmatic celebrity, but a meditation on athletic genius, drawing on interviews with Messi himself, as well as with everyone from his family, teammates, childhood friends—even his favorite butcher. In-depth and intimate, soccer fans who enjoy watching Messi come alive on the field will delight as he comes alive on the page.

Read all about Argentinian soccer superstar Lionel Messi and his legendary career in this book from Who HQ Now, the series featuring the trending topics and news makers of today. Lionel Messi loved soccer from an early age, often playing with his family members with encouragement from his grandmother. Now, he is regarded as one of the greatest players of all time! He is also one of the most decorated footballers in the world--having won 44 collective trophies, including seven Ballon d'Or awards, 2009 FIFA World Player of the Year, 2019 and 2022 Best FIFA Men's Player, and more. From making his first team debut at just sixteen years old in 2003 to breaking numerous longstanding records in 2012, to helping Argentina win the 2022 World Cup, Messi continues to wow fans with his finesse of the soccer ball. However, Lionel Messi stays true to his roots, never forgetting a small tribute to his grandmother each time he scores a goal by looking up and pointing to the sky. Learn about Lionel's epic career and his lifelong love for soccer in this illustrated biography for young readers.
